Reported Resistance Case(s)

Species: helicoverpa armigera

Order Family Common Name(s) Group Host
lepidoptera noctuidae cotton bollworm AG cotton, corn, sorghum, tomato

Active Ingredient: Bacillus thuringiensis MVP II

MOA: Microbial disruptors of insect midgut membranes (includes transgenic crops), Bacillus thuringiensis var.inhibitors kurstaki
Group: BAC CAS #: n/a Shaugnessy Code: n/a

Resistance Case(s)

Case Id Year of Report Location Reference
2003 Australia Akhurst, R. J., W. James, L. Bird, and C. Beard. (2003). Resistance to the Cry1Ac endotoxin of Bacillus thuringiensis in the Cottom Bollworm, Helicoverpa armigera (Lepidoptera: Noctuidae). J. Econ. Entomol., 96(4), 1290-1299.

2002 Australia Cooke, L.R. (2002). Evidence of shift in susceptibility of Bacillus thuringiensis delta-endotoxin Cry1Ac in Australia Helicoverpa armigera (Lepidoptera: Noctuidae). Resistance Pest Management Newsletter, 11(2), 44-48.
1991 China -- Henan -- Yanshi City Fengxia, M., J. Shen, W. Zhou, and H. Cen. (2003). Long-term selection for resistance to transgenic cotton expressing Bacillus thuringiensis toxin in helicoverpa armigera (Hubner) (Lepidoptera: Noctuidae). Pest Managment Science, 60, 167-172.
